Best Suited For

This contract template was created for entrepreneurs who are hiring people as employees (you pay their taxes and have control over their hours, what they work on, and can potentially give them a non-compete). This contract template will work for any type of business and is drafted from the perspective of the company hiring the employee.

If you are hiring team members as 1099 Contractors, then you should check out our Independent Contractor Agreement

disclaimer

DISCLAIMER: By purchasing a template contract and/or document from The Legal Paige, LLC, you are not given access to Paige and no attorney-client relationship is created.

All template documents are drafted using general U.S. contract principles and are not state-specific. Our products are easy-to-use and have highlighted, editable sections with commentary on what to amend according to your business practices and local state laws. You may modify the document on your own or find an attorney in your state to help you.

Some template documents are available in Canada, have been reviewed by a Canadian lawyer, and are drafted using general Canadian common law contract principles (not for use in Quebec due to civil law jurisdiction). Thus, if you purchase a Canadian template all language in the document will be applicable to your business operating in Canada. If you need assistance modifying the document, please find lawyer in your territory/province to help you.
